  • 1. To what extent did you enjoy your work placement or internship?
  • It was a great experience where I learnt a vast amount of knowledge regarding the industry and how it operates. The people I worked with were very friendly and always willing to help and support me whenever I needed it. The work I completed was interesting, insightful and for the most part enjoyable.

  • 3. To what extent were you given support and guidance by management/your supervisor(s)?
  • Contact with my supervisor was at times limited due to the locations of where I was working. Having said this if I required any support or help, they were still more than willing to try and arrange a meeting in person as soon as they possibly can. I also had support from other colleagues who would willingly provide guidance at any point.

  • 4. How busy were you on a daily basis?
  • My work load did fluctuate throughout the duration of my placement. At times I would have a quite a lot to complete and at other times I may be asking around for more tasks to do. During the working week I would regular find myself moving from place to place to attend meetings and other sites which was in a way a good thing as it helped to break up the type of work that I was doing.

  • 9. In terms of personal training and development, to what extent did the company or firm invest in you?
  • The company had me go on a 2 day training course that was fully paid for to enable me to have the correct certification to go on site. The company have also spent a lot of time reviewing my progress and are looking at how they can work with me to develop my career in the future.

  • 13. What was the cost of living and socialising in the area you worked in?
  • The cost of living was not too bad as I was able to easily commute from my home. Due to the location of where I worked which was outside of London, prices for food etc. was reasonable. Travel costs however did mount up quickly but I was able to claim this back at the end of each month.
